A Systems Approach to Modeling Catastrophic Risk and Insurability

A. Amendola, Y. Ermoliev, T. Ermolieva, V. Gitis, G. Koff and J. Linnerooth-Bayer

Natural Hazards: Journal of the International Society for the Prevention and Mitigation of Natural Hazards, 2000, vol. 21, issue 2, 393 pages

Abstract: This paper describes a spatial-dynamic,stochastic optimization model that takes account ofthe complexities and dependencies of catastrophicrisks. Following a description of the general model,the paper briefly discusses a case study of earthquakerisk in the Irkutsk region of Russia. For this purposethe risk management model is customized to explicitlyincorporate the geological characteristics of theregion, as well as the seismic hazards and thevulnerability of the built environment. In its generalform, the model can analyze the interplay betweeninvestment in mitigation and risk-sharing measures. Inthe application described in this paper, the modelgenerates insurance strategies that are lessvulnerable to insolvency. Copyright Kluwer Academic Publishers 2000
